The Oklahoma Department of Transportation is planning repairs for two bridges in Norman using funds from the federal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act.
The bridges are located at Willow Grove Drive and on Indian Hills Road near the Belmar Golf Club.
The funding is part of a program focused on repairing structurally deficient bridges, according to the City of Norman.
Oklahoma’s Bridge Formula Program, part of the federal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act, will fund repairs for two bridges in Norman: Bridge Number 14930 on Willow Grove Drive and Bridge Number 19418 on Indian Hills Road.
The projects are scheduled to go out for bid in September. The repairs are "100 percent federally funded and do not require a match from the municipality," and all work will be done within the existing right of way.
